INNOVISION FOODS PRIVATE LIMITED Details
INNOVISION FOODS PRIVATE LIMITED is a food production company based out of #221/298, SINGASANDRAHOSUR ROAD BANGALORE, BANGALORE, Karnataka, India.
Employees:
0
HQ:
Location:
Bengaluru, Karnataka, India
Revenue: